Typological approach to prediction of clinical peculiarities of chronic alcoholism
(RESUME)

The problem of construction of non-linear prognostic models is dealt with. A method of by-piece approximation is suggested as a means of increasing the reliability of predictions. In this case the procedure of making a prediction consists of two stages: first subjects are divided by types, then a particular prognostic equation is composed for each type. A complex function is therefore represented by a composition of "simple" functions (e. g. linear functions or constant functions) each corresponding to a particular sub-sample. Efficiency of the approach is illustrated by exemplary instances of prediction of outcomes of clinical treatment of chronic alcoholics on the basis of their personality characteristics.
